
The name Laila is of Arabic origin and means "night" or "nocturnal beauty." It is also a common name in Persian, Urdu, and other languages spoken in the Middle East and South Asia. The name is often associated with the Arabic love story "Layla and Majnun," which tells the tragic tale of a young man who falls in love with a woman named Layla but is unable to marry her due to family objections.

One famous person with the first name Laila is Laila Ali, the retired professional boxer and daughter of legendary boxer Muhammad Ali. Laila Ali had an impressive career, winning multiple world titles and remaining undefeated throughout her boxing career. She is also known for her philanthropy work, advocating for children's health and wellness. Another famous Laila is Laila Robins, an American actress known for her roles in film, television, and theater. She has appeared in popular TV shows such as "The Sopranos" and "Homeland," as well as in Broadway productions like "Heartbreak House" and "The Herbal Bed." Both Laila Ali and Laila Robins have made significant contributions to their respective industries and are celebrated for their talent and achievements.
Laila, a beautiful name with various spellings and pronunciations across different cultures and languages. In Arabic, it is commonly spelled as Layla or Leila, while in Hebrew it can be written as Lila or Leila. In Sanskrit, the name is often spelled as Laila or Leela. Variations such as Laela, Leyla, and Leila are also popular in different parts of the world.
